Suzuki’s Compact, Low-Emission Hatchback – made in India for the World
Suzuki Motor Corp has a new compact hatchback that will be manufactured in India and sold all over the world.
Suzuki wants India to be the company's export hub.
Suzuki also wants to maintain its majority share in the Indian market.
"Our next world car will be made in India," says Suzuki's CEO.
Production will begin in the fall of 2008.
The car is expected to be a one-liter car that meets stringent pollution control rules and keep carbon emissions lower than European cars.
And cheap….price has not been disclosed.
The car has a name – A-Star.
Suzuki has a a 54% stake in Maruti, India's largest carmaker, which has a 54% market share in India.
The JV wants to make 150,000 cars a year, one third of which will be exported.
The car is unique in that Maruti Suzuki's R & D division in India has been involved from the beginning.
